Subject: [PATCH i-g-t] tests/intel/gem_spin_batch: Skip compute engines on DG2 due to w/a
Date: Fri, 16 Aug 2024 14:31:10 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240816213110.718186-1-jonathan.cavitt@intel.com> (raw)
Much like MTL, there's a w/a on DG2 that prevent the execution of
multiple non-preemptible processes on RCS and CCS. So, prevent the
running of CCS engines in the 'spin-all-new' test, extending the MTL
solution to DG2.

diff --git a/tests/intel/gem_spin_batch.c b/tests/intel/gem_spin_batch.c
index 682a062180..85408a4c0d 100644
--- a/tests/intel/gem_spin_batch.c
+++ b/tests/intel/gem_spin_batch.c
@@ -161,16 +161,24 @@ spin_on_all_engines(int fd, const intel_ctx_t *ctx,
}
/*
- * Wa_14019159160:
- * An RCS/CCS workaround on MTL means that contexts from different address spaces
- * cannot run in parallel, they must be timesliced. However, a non-preemptible
- * spinner cannot be timesliced. Thus the PARALLEL_SPIN_NEW_CTX test cannot be run
- * across both RCS and CCS engines, one or other must be skipped for the test to
- * not hit a heartbeat timeout and be killed.
+ * Wa_14019159160:MTL
+ * Wa_114014494547:DG2
+ * An RCS/CCS workaround on some platforms means that contexts from different
+ * address spaces cannot run in parallel, they must be timesliced. However, a
+ * non-preemptible spinner cannot be timesliced. Thus the PARALLEL_SPIN_NEW_CTX
+ * test cannot be run across both RCS and CCS engines, one or other must be
+ * skipped for the test to not hit a heartbeat timeout and be killed.
*/
static bool skip_bad_engine(int fd, const struct intel_execution_engine2 *e)
{
- return IS_METEORLAKE(intel_get_drm_devid(fd)) && (e->class == I915_ENGINE_CLASS_COMPUTE);
+ uint32_t devid = intel_get_drm_devid(fd);
+
+ if (IS_METEORLAKE(devid) && (e->class == I915_ENGINE_CLASS_COMPUTE))
+ return true;
+ else if (IS_DG2(devid) && (e->class == I915_ENGINE_CLASS_COMPUTE))
+ return true;
+ else
+ return false;
}
